For those who care, I'm using Cygnet 100% acrylic yarn; I knit within my means, and am allergic to wool... if I had a million pounds I'd knit in nothing but my favorite bamboo/silk or bamboo/cotton blends, but there we go.... In this set of pictures, I'm working on a Kate Davies Owlet for my daughter. It'll be my third KD Owls; I made mine first, Squidge got jealous and demanded one, then the little bean grew... so I'm having to knit her a new one. I'm using a 6.5mm bamboo circular needle that's about 40cm long. I say about, I had to modify it using a craft knife and some superglue. It's a really cheap needle that's still yellow after a disaster with hand dyed yarn last summer (I didn't rinse enough).
